The service details have been announced for the funeral of David Morris.

The respected musician was the conductor of Woodhouse Prize Silver Band and a cornet player with Chapeltown Silver Band.

He was also a popular photographer, graphic designer and banding enthusiast who was well known for being an integral part of the success of the Bolsover Festival of Brass, Bolsover International Brass Band Summer School and Wychavon Festival of Brass.

Funeral

The funeral will be held on Monday 20th November at 1.00pm at City Road Crematorium, Sheffield.

All friends, colleagues, bandsmen welcome.

The family has requested no flowers except for the immediate family.

Donations

All donations will be in aid of Chesterfield Canal Trust and the Yorkshire Brass Band Regional Championships, where a trophy will be donated in his memory.

Please make cheques payable to H. Keeton and send to H Keeton, Funeral Directors: Highfield Lane, Sheffield, South Yorkshire, S13 9NA.
